This event is part of the philosophy sponsorship activities (*) undertaken with member companies of the ANTLERS BUSINESS CLUB.
(*) What is philosophy sponsorship activity?
The ANTLERS BUSINESS CLUB uses a portion of its membership fees as "philosophy sponsorship funds" to support activities aimed at contributing to the community and society.

You can choose your favorite sport from a total of six types, including popular sports like soccer, baseball, and dance (hip-hop), as well as rugby, track and field, and "Sports Onigokko" which adds game elements to the popular children's game of tag. Participation in all events is free, and as a participation prize, you will receive one ticket (East Zone, elementary, junior high, and high school) to the FC Tokyo match!

A soccer clinic for elementary school students will also be held, where participants can receive direct instruction from Akira Narahashi, a former Antlers player who was active in the J-League and for the Japan national team.
